430819 2006-02-16 05:08:00 Can I, using Word, get an email attachment written in Chinese, display it on my screen, and print it out?

I don't need to write Chinese, just receive as described.

A possible problem is that my (100% legal :) ) XP Home Edition with Office 2002 was interfered with when the university where I no longer work installed Word 2003 following a botch-up which was their fault. A free upgrade in one sense, but it means I can no longer insert CDs when requested - for example when installing requested files during the Regional and Language Options setup.

430820 2006-02-16 06:27:00 I'm pretty sure that for Office 2003, you only need the English version to be able to read Chinese. The fonts on your PC should contain the chinese characters via unicode ... although some people may be use their own special chinese fonts.

Read this (www.microsoft.com)

For Office XP you need language packs.

The option: Regional and Language Options is not related to Office but to Windows XP itself and as I understand it you only need it for typing in Asian characters...
